linux安装tree命令安装不上
-
要在Linux系统上安装tree命令,可以按照以下步骤进行操作:
1. 确保系统具有适当的软件包管理器。常见的Linux发行版如Ubuntu使用apt,CentOS使用yum,Arch Linux使用pacman等。确保你有root或sudo权限。
2. 打开终端,更新软件包列表。执行以下命令:
– 使用apt(Debian或Ubuntu):
“`
sudo apt update
“`– 使用yum(CentOS或Fedora):
“`
sudo yum update
“`– 使用pacman(Arch Linux):
“`
sudo pacman -Syu
“`3. 安装tree命令。执行以下命令:
– 使用apt(Debian或Ubuntu):
“`
sudo apt install tree
“`– 使用yum(CentOS或Fedora):
“`
sudo yum install tree
“`– 使用pacman(Arch Linux):
“`
sudo pacman -S tree
“`4. 等待安装完成。安装过程可能需要一些时间,取决于你的系统网络和性能。
5. 验证tree命令是否安装成功。在终端中执行以下命令:
“`
tree –version
“`如果命令输出tree的版本信息,则表示安装成功。
如果按照上述步骤仍然无法安装tree命令,可能存在以下原因:
– 不能访问软件包仓库:确保你的网络连接正常,并且你的软件源配置正确。
– 未安装正确的软件包管理工具:检查你的系统是否具有适当的软件包管理工具,并按照上述步骤操作。
– 系统不兼容:确保你的Linux发行版支持tree命令,并查找其他可用的替代方案。
– 出现错误或警告:查看终端输出,确认是否有任何错误或警告信息。根据提示解决问题。
希望上述方法能帮助你成功安装tree命令。如果问题仍然存在,请提供更多详细信息以便我们进一步协助解决。
2年前 -
如果在 Linux 系统上安装 tree 命令时遇到问题,可能是因为以下几个原因:
1. 未安装 tree 软件包:在某些 Linux 发行版本中,tree 命令可能不是默认安装的。您可以尝试使用包管理器安装 tree 软件包。例如,对于基于 Debian 或 Ubuntu 的系统,可以使用以下命令进行安装:
“`
sudo apt-get install tree
“`
对于基于 Red Hat、CentOS、Fedora 的系统,可以使用以下命令进行安装:
“`
sudo yum install tree
“`2. 软件源配置问题:如果您的系统无法从默认软件源中找到 tree 软件包,可能是因为您的软件源配置有问题。您可以尝试更新软件源并重新安装 tree 软件包。具体命令取决于您正在使用的 Linux 发行版。
3. 网络连接问题:如果您的系统无法连接到互联网,您将无法从软件源中下载 tree 软件包。请确保您的网络连接正常,并尝试重新安装 tree 软件包。
4. 权限问题:您可能没有足够的权限安装软件包。如果您通过普通用户账户登录,请尝试使用 sudo 命令以管理员权限安装软件包。如果您正在以 root 用户身份登录,请确保您具有正确的权限。
5. 包管理器问题:如果您正在使用非标准的包管理器,可能会导致无法安装 tree 软件包。请检查您的包管理器是否支持 tree 软件包,并尝试其他可用的方法。
如果您尝试了以上解决方法仍然无法安装 tree 命令,您可以尝试从源代码编译和安装 tree 命令。您可以从 tree 官方网站(http://mama.indstate.edu/users/ice/tree/) 下载最新的源代码,并按照源代码目录中的说明进行编译和安装。这种方法可能需要一些额外的依赖项,具体取决于您的系统配置。
2年前 -
在Linux上安装tree命令非常简单,只需要执行几个简单的步骤。以下是安装tree命令的方法和操作流程。
1. 检查tree命令是否已经安装
打开终端窗口,执行以下命令:
“`
tree
“`
如果系统已经安装tree命令,则会显示该命令的帮助信息。如果系统没有安装tree命令,则会提示“找不到命令”或类似的错误信息。2. 安装tree命令
如果tree命令没有安装在系统中,可以通过以下几种方式进行安装:– 使用包管理器进行安装:
a.对于Debian或者Ubuntu系统,可以使用以下命令安装tree命令:
“`
sudo apt-get update
sudo apt-get install tree
“`
b.对于CentOS或者Fedora系统,可以使用yum包管理器进行安装:
“`
sudo yum install tree
“`
– 编译并安装tree命令
如果以上方法不能安装tree命令,可以尝试从源代码编译并安装。a.首先,需要从tree命令的官方网站下载最新的源代码压缩包。可以通过以下链接访问官方网站:https://github.com/nitrocode/Tree
b.在终端窗口中,使用wget命令下载源代码压缩包:
“`
wget https://github.com/nitrocode/Tree/archive/master.zip
“`
c.解压缩下载的压缩包:
“`
unzip master.zip
“`
d.进入解压缩后的目录:
“`
cd Tree-master
“`
e.编译并安装tree命令:
“`
make
sudo make install
“`3. 验证安装是否成功
在终端窗口中,执行以下命令进行验证:
“`
tree
“`
如果成功安装,将会显示当前目录下的文件和子目录的树形结构。以上就是在Linux上安装tree命令的方法和操作流程。根据不同的系统和配置,可以选择使用包管理器安装或者从源代码编译安装。同时,可以在安装完成后,通过验证命令来确认tree命令是否成功安装。
2年前